Tóm lại: Discover the IEC62368 Three Vertical Bar Signal RDL-100 video signal generator, designed for digital TV testing. This versatile tool supports CVBS, YPbPr, and HDMI interfaces, offering PAL/NTSC calibration and ultra-HD 4K video formats. Perfect for TV safety and electromagnetic compatibility tests.
Đặc điểm sản phẩm liên quan:
  • Supports CVBS, YPbPr, and HDMI interfaces for comprehensive TV testing.
  • Compatible with PAL and NTSC video formats for global applications.
  • Offers HD video formats including 1280x720p and 1920x1080p at various frequencies.
  • Includes ultra-HD 4K video formats (3840x2160p) for advanced testing needs.
  • Features a touch screen interface for easy signal and format selection.
  • Equipped with navigation keys and a digital keyboard for user-friendly operation.
  • Includes USB ports for connecting external devices like mice and keyboards.
  • Provides precise technical indicators for accurate signal output measurements.

  • What interfaces does the Three Vertical Bar Signal Generator support?
    The generator supports CVBS, YPbPr, and HDMI interfaces, making it versatile for various TV testing scenarios.
  • Can this generator be used for ultra-HD (4K) video formats?
    Yes, it supports ultra-HD 4K video formats, specifically 3840x2160p at 25Hz and 30Hz.
  • What are the main applications of this video signal generator?
    It is primarily used for TV safety tests, electromagnetic compatibility tests, and other related TV testing experiments.
